Introduction
i!-EquipmentMonitor is an application that allows you to send and receive e-mail directly from a
NetLinx Control System. i!-EquipmentMonitor is primarily used to send and receive NetLinx
Control System e-mails, such as sending e-mail notifications for system problems or equipment
trouble and receiving
e-mails for Control System messaging. i!-EquipmentMonitor consists of the following files:
i!-EquipmentMonitorIn.axi is an include file for receiving e-mails using POP3
protocol.
i!-EquipmentMonitorOut.axi is an include file for sending e-mails using SMTP
protocol.
i!-EquipmentMonitorTest.axs is a test program using both i!-EquipmentMonitorIn.axi
and i!-EquipmentMonitorOut.axi.

Supported Operating Systems

Windows 95®/98® (with at least 48 MB of installed memory)
Windows NT 4.0® Workstation or Server (service pack 6 B or greater, with at least
64 MB of installed memory)
Windows 2000® Professional or Server (running on a Pentium 233 MHz processor
(minimum requirement); 300 MHz or faster recommended, with 96 MB of installed
memory.)

Minimum PC Requirements

Windows-compatible mouse (or other pointing device)
At least 5 MB of free disk space (150 MB recommended)
VGA monitor, with a minimum screen resolution of 800 x 600
A Network adapter
A Web server such as Personal Web Server (PWS) or Internet Information Server (IIS)
Windows 95® and 98® use PWS.
Windows 2000® Professional or Server, and Windows NT 4.0® Server use IIS.
